Sce Pol I is a family B enzyme from S. cerevisiea.

Selected Properties for Sce Pol I:

3'-5' exo activity 5'-3' exo activity Frameshift Rate Substitution Rate General Error Rate
No (1) no data 5.9e-05 errors/bp (1) 8.3e-05 errors/bp (1) 1.1e-04 errors/bp (1)
